vaguely
Word Type: Adverb
Definition
In a way that is unclear, imprecise, or lacking in detail.
Example
- “She vaguely remembered meeting him at a party years ago.”
- “The instructions were written vaguely, making it hard to follow.”
- “He spoke vaguely about his future plans, not giving much detail.”
- “I vaguely recall seeing that movie, but I don’t remember the plot.”
- “The report vaguely touched on the issue but didn’t provide any solutions.”
